28:31Now PlayingAccording to Forbes, there are about 45 million Americans who collectively owe $1.7 trillion dollars in student loan debt. Senator Zach Duckworth, R-Lakeville, joins Capitol Report moderator Shannon Loehrke to talk about the Student Borrowers Bill of Rights, a bill that would ensure student loan servicers in Minnesota handle the loans ethically and responsibly.
Senator Chuck Wiger, DFL-Maplewood, minority lead of the Senate E-12 Education Committee, joins Shannon to outline the priorities of Governor Tim Walz’s Due North Education Plan and the educational needs of students as the state emerges from the COVID-19 pandemic.
Finally, highlights from Senate’s vote to require legislative approval for future extensions of gubernatorial emergency powers and of the Republican-led Senate’s $51.9 billion budget plan for the FY2022-23 biennium.
